ChangePoint Behavioral Health, located in Lewiston, Idaho, is a private organization providing comprehensive outpatient treatment for adults with co-occurring mental health and substance use disorders. Their mission is to offer an accessible, effective pathway to recovery, integrating evidence-based therapies with a compassionate approach. They are committed to fostering lasting change and empowering individuals towards a healthier future.
The center employs a diverse array of therapeutic interventions tailored to adult needs. These include robust group therapy, individualized 1-on-1 counseling, and family therapy to strengthen support systems. Core modalities such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), trauma-specific therapy, and Twelve Step Facilitation are integral. Clients also benefit from practical life skills training, flexible online therapy, relapse prevention counseling, motivational interviewing, and couples counseling.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) is available.

MedicaidMedicaidA joint federal and state program providing health coverage to low-income individuals and families. Medicaid covers substance abuse treatment including detox, residential rehab, outpatient services, and medication-assisted treatment, varying by state.
